The campground stretches along the north bank of the North Yuba River. Stands of oak, maple, locust and pine trees covers the area providing ample shade at this location.
Recreation: The North Yuba River offers swimming, wading and rainbow trout fishing. Seasonal rafting, kayaking and tubing are popular water activities. Hiking and hunting are available in the surrounding area. A network of trails crisscrosses the surrounding area. A footbridge accessing the North Yuba Trail is located at nearby Rocky Rest Campground.
